blues

blues (music genre)

noun BLOOS Rare

Origin: Borrowed from English 'blues', from the phrase 'blue devils' (melancholy).

Usage Note

Blues is an uninflected English loanword used in Spanish for the musical genre and its cultural associations. It is always masculine (el blues) and invariable — the plural form is identical to the singular. Spanish musicians and critics use it freely: tocar blues, un guitarrista de blues. The melancholic emotional state sometimes called 'the blues' in English is expressed differently in Spanish, often as melancolía or tristeza.
